Arctornis cygna

It is found in Bengal, Sikkim, China,[1] Taiwan[2] Sri Lanka and Thailand.

Abdomen fulvous and forelegs are bright orange.

Forewings with white basal area from the costa middle to outer angle, where the rest of the wing is hyaline with traces of a postmedial band of silvery scales.

In the female, the whole forewings are pure white with three raised bands of silvery-white scales on the outer half of the wing.

[3] The larvae have been reported feeding on Durio zibethinus.
